Mark’s area of focus reflects his own experience – he works with executives, engineers, and technical professionals in transition. These transitions include retirement, mid-life career change, and widowhood.

Mark recognizes that spreadsheets are only part of financial planning and investment management. He enjoys collaborating with clients on goals and complex issues to help them understand their financial life. He provides customized guidance from an experienced, knowledgeable viewpoint that always has the clients’ best interests at the forefront. He brings in the proper professionals and strategies to ensure actions are completed and future needs are anticipated.

Mark is a CERTIFIED FINANCIAL PLANNER™ and a Certified Public Accountant (CPA). He received his BBA in accounting and finance from James Madison University and his MBA from Loyola University, Maryland.

In addition to his financial planning background, Mark has 20 years of experience in corporate accounting and management. Mark’s corporate experience involved working with engineers, mathematicians, and scientists with high-tech companies in the Baltimore-Washington area.
